That depends a lot of who you mean with "her majesty". Several countries still have monarchies, which are either governed by a queen, or by a king - but in the latter case, the king's wife (should he have one) would also be called "her majesty".

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II is Supreme Governor of The Church of England, and is a regular church-goer.
